Before I dive into the very best gigs for tweens, let me very first cover the laws regarding child labor. If you're not familiar, I'll provide you the basic essence: On the federal level, kid labor laws are set by the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), which sets the minimum age requirements for kid work, including limiting the number of hours kids can work, along with designating the kinds of jobs kids can have. Generally, the minimum age for employment is 14, however exceptions exist for jobs like paper delivery, childcare, and agricultural work, where children can work from a more youthful age under specific conditions.

Each state may also have its own laws, which can be stricter than federal laws. In California, for instance, the legal working age is 14 years old. However, kids under 14 and even under 12 can legally work without a license doing things like lawn mowing, selling arts and crafts, and babysitting, to call simply a few. Minors can likewise work certain farming jobs, if the kid is utilized by a parent or legal guardian who controls, runs, or owns the residential or commercial property.

Children over 14, while legally enabled to work numerous jobs, face a lot of limitations. However, that's an entire other topic that I'll likely cover in a future post!

- What are some popular jobs for 12 years of age?

The most popular jobs for 12 years of age consist of childcare, family pet sitting, lawn work, dog walking, and mother's assistant.

While 12 years of age are not legally allowed to work in more conventional roles like those at fast food dining establishments, they can work in a personal home setting doing the above mentioned tasks.

- Are there any limitations or constraints on jobs for 12 year olds?

Yes, there are some constraints and restrictions on jobs for 12 years of age. The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A) sets standards for the kinds of jobs and number of hours that young workers can undertake. For instance, 12 years of age typically can not work in harmful professions or throughout school hours. It's essential to talk to your local and state laws, as well as obtain any required authorizations or consents.
